We are at a critical moment, teetering at the edge of climate catastrophe. Yet Eversource plans a new natural gas pipeline, larger and higher pressure than any existing pipelines in Springfield.  It is a fossil fuel expansion project, not a “reliability project”. Methane, the main component of natural gas, is a greenhouse gas 80 times more potent than carbon dioxide over 20 years. We need to reduce our greenhouse gas emissions as fast as we can, not invest $35-35 million in a climate-killing fossil fuel expansion project. This is a dangerous and irresponsible project. Last year, Massachusetts took vital steps to respond to the climate crisis by passing the Climate Roadmap bill which mandates a 50% reduction in greenhouse gas emissions by 2030 and net zero by 2050. Yet @EversourceMA wants to drag us in the wrong direction by building the unhealthy, unnecessary, and climate changing Springfield-Longmeadow pipeline. How does Eversource plan to meet emissions reductions standards after building a new pipeline, especially when they wouldn’t be breaking ground until 2024?
